Web18 mei 2024 · The Army Combat Fitness Test has been revised to take into account gender and age in assessing fitness levels. Changes include gender- and age-normed scoring scales, a plank as the sole exercise to assess core strength, and a 2.5 mile walk as an alternative aerobic activity. WebSo lets take Physical Fitness on this picture. If you max the ACFT, you will get the maximum points of 180 on the current promotion point breakdown. That is saying a 600 on the ACFT is worth 180 points and lets say you get a 590, thats worth 178 points instead. With the new changes in 2024 the ACFT will be worth less points.

Web5 okt. 2024 · The ACFT consistes of these six exercises: 3 Repetition Maximum Deadlift – Deadlift the maximum weight possible three times. Standing Power Throw – Throw a 10-pound medicine ball backward and overhead for distance. Hand Release Push-Up- Army Extension – Complete as many Hand-Release Push-ups as possible in two minutes.
